I wanted to mention to you a lesser known first-person adventure game called "Dare to Dream".  And it is really bizarre.

Here are videos of a playthrough of the three volumes (parts, episodes, whatever) of the game.

Volume 1: In a Darkened Room https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=fyo22H2Liuk
Volume 2: In Search of the Beast https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=bzgqnx8VXi8
Volume 3: Christian's Lair https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=kGuxraCjrOQ

(Don't let the name "Christian" fool you.  He is the main antagonist, and a demon.  In fact, Volume 3 has it look like you're in a version of hell itself!)

Like I said, bizarre.  And this game was created by the same dude who'd later go on to create Jazz Jackrabbit!
